Nyeman Wangsu from Longding, Arunachal Pradesh, has been selected to represent India at the 17th World Wushu Championship in Brasília, Brazil, to be held from September 1 to 8. She will travel with Team India from New Delhi to compete at the global stage.
A three-time National Games gold medalist, Wangsu created history by winning Arunachal Pradesh’s first-ever gold medal at the 38th National Games in Uttarakhand in the Daoshu event. She had earlier secured gold medals at the 36th and 37th National Games held in Gujarat and Goa.
The All Arunachal Pradesh Wushu Association (AAPWA), which has played a key role in promoting the sport, expressed pride in Wangsu’s achievement. Wushu is currently the state’s top medal-winning sport, with athletes making their presence felt not only in national competitions but also at the Asian Games.
AAPWA general secretary John Tara Bakey facilitated Wangsu’s participation, while coach Prem Chandra Singh of Sangey Lhaden Sports Academy provided technical training. Extending best wishes, the association said it hoped Wangsu would once again make the nation proud on the world stage.
